Runbook: Queue migration cutover. This week we finish replacing the homegrown Drelfort job queue with Cinderbus. Drain legacy workers by pausing the scheduler, wait for in-flight jobs to settle, then flip the producer flag. Keep the legacy consumers warm for 48 hours in case of rollback. Verify throughput on the Cinderbus dashboard before declaring done. The cutover build is identified by the token below.

pipeline stamp: htk9_ce63042d9

Migration slipped six weeks; root cause is vendor data-mapping errors plus internal resourcing gaps. Sandoval to renegotiate the Tellvane statement of work by Friday. Imrie reassigning two engineers from the Brightloom workstream. Revised go-live: first week of next quarter. Budget overrun currently 8%, contained. Weekly status reports to continue until recovery confirmed. Decision ratified unanimously. Background on why this project matters to the broader plan is recorded below.

board note of bajop-yaweg: The western region missed its Pelys quota by 58.0 percent last quarter. Pelysek Foods plans to raise the Belius list price by 44.0 percent in July. The steering committee signed off on a budget of $133.8 million for Project Pelax. The renewal with Zoraelix Systems closes at $61.9 million a year, 12.7 percent above the last contract.

Runbook: Nightfill scheduler. Runs backfills at 01:30 via the Cronmere worker. To trigger manually, enqueue a job with the target date range and priority flag. Failures retry three times, then page on-call. Config lives in the worker env file. The scheduler needs a warehouse credential to write results, and it is set on the following line.

vault entry, yahif-yajep: COURIER_KEY29=b802bdf8034096b65a51c6ba5abe2

- [ ] Weekly cash-box run to the Hallowmere annex. Confirm both lockable boxes are sealed and logged in the records ledger before 10:00. Reconcile the tally sheet against last week's figures and flag any variance over two units to the records supervisor. The courier from Bryncastle Secure collects from the side entrance. The confidential hand-over instruction follows below.

drop instructions, bawep-tahaf: the praix belion courier leaves the lamix holdor tamwyn kasix tamael ulays wenath wenox ledger at gate 6249 under passcode 007677